Understanding Cancer Recurrence

Cancer recurrence is a term that refers to the return of cancer after a period of remission. Remission indicates that the signs and symptoms of cancer have diminished or disappeared. However, cancer can recur in various forms: local, regional, or distant. Local recurrence occurs when cancer returns to the same location as the original tumor. Regional recurrence involves the cancer returning to nearby lymph nodes or areas close to where it was first diagnosed. Distant recurrence, on the other hand, refers to the spread of cancer to organs or tissues far from the original site, often referred to as metastatic cancer.

Statistics on cancer recurrence rates highlight that these figures can vary significantly based on several factors, including the type of cancer diagnosed, the treatments received, and individual patient characteristics. For example, according to research, rates of recurrence can be high for certain aggressive cancers, such as breast cancer or lung cancer, especially if the initial treatment was not fully effective. Factors such as the stage at which the cancer was initially diagnosed and the effectiveness of surgical and adjuvant therapies play crucial roles in the likelihood of recurrence.

It is also important to distinguish recurrence from a new cancer diagnosis. A recurrence indicates that the original cancer has returned, while a new diagnosis signifies the emergence of a different type of cancer or a cancer that arises in an unrelated organ system. This differentiation is critical as it influences treatment plans, prognosis, and patient management. Signs and Symptoms of Recurrence

The recurrence of cancer can manifest in various ways, and recognizing these signs early is crucial for effective intervention. Patients must remain vigilant and aware of any new or returning symptoms that could signal a relapse. Common symptoms associated with cancer recurrence often depend on the type of cancer and its original site, but some general indicators may include unexplained weight loss, persistent pain in a specific area, and notable changes in appetite.

Additionally, new lumps or growths that emerge in the vicinity of the original tumor site may raise concerns. For example, if a patient had breast cancer and notices a lump in the breast or armpit, this should prompt immediate medical evaluation. Other symptoms may include fatigue that does not improve with rest, frequent infections due to an immune system compromised by cancer, and changes in skin color or texture. These signs are important to discuss with healthcare providers, as they can provide thorough assessments and necessary follow-up tests.

Maintaining ongoing communication with healthcare providers is vital in monitoring health conditions post-treatment. They can offer guidance on routine screenings or tests that measure cancer markers, which can aid in early detection. It is essential for patients to attend regular follow-up appointments, as health professionals can observe and assess for any indications of recurrence.

Risk Factors for Cancer Recurrence

Cancer recurrence, or the return of cancer after treatment, is a significant concern for many survivors. Understanding the various risk factors that contribute to the likelihood of recurrence can empower individuals to make informed choices regarding their health management. Among the primary factors influencing cancer recurrence are genetic predispositions, lifestyle choices, types of previous treatments, and the biological characteristics of specific tumors.

Genetic predispositions play a pivotal role in cancer risk. Certain inherited genetic mutations, such as BRCA1 and BRCA2, have been linked to a higher likelihood of recurrence in breast and ovarian cancers. Individuals with a family history of cancer may also be at an increased risk, highlighting the importance of genetic counseling for those with significant family backgrounds of malignancies. This knowledge can guide proactive monitoring and preventive measures.

Lifestyle factors are another crucial element influencing cancer recurrence. Elements such as maintaining a healthy diet, regular physical activity, smoking cessation, and limiting alcohol intake are essential lifestyle modifications. Research has shown that a balanced diet rich in fruits and vegetables can help bolster the immune system, while physical activity may help mitigate stress and enhance overall well-being, potentially reducing the risk of cancer returning.

The type of treatment received initially can also impact recurrence risk. For instance, patients treated with surgery alone may face different risks compared to those who have undergone chemotherapy or radiation therapy. Additionally, the biological characteristics of tumors, such as hormone receptor status or genetic markers, can influence recurrence rates. Understanding these aspects is essential for tailoring follow-up care and surveillance strategies.

Diagnostic Tests for Recurrence Evaluation

When cancer patients complete their initial treatment, they often face the uncertainty of recurrence. To address this concern, healthcare professionals utilize a range of diagnostic tools to evaluate whether cancer has returned. These evaluations typically include imaging studies, blood tests, and biopsies, each serving a critical role in recurrence assessment.

Imaging studies such as Magnetic Resonance Imaging (MRI) and Computed Tomography (CT) scans play a vital role in visualizing internal organs and identifying the presence of cancer. These non-invasive tests generate detailed images, allowing healthcare providers to detect any abnormal growths or changes in the body that could indicate a recurrence. Patients can generally expect to lie still during these scans, which may last anywhere from 30 minutes to an hour, depending on the complexity of the test. The results are interpreted by radiologists, who will provide insights on whether further investigation is warranted.

In addition to imaging, blood tests that measure tumor markers are utilized to assess cancer recurrence risk. Tumor markers are substances produced by cancer cells or the body in response to cancer. Their levels can indicate whether cancer may be present. Common tumor markers include CA-125 for ovarian cancer and PSA for prostate cancer. These blood tests are relatively straightforward, involving a simple blood draw that can usually be done in a clinic or laboratory. The results can help guide physicians in determining the next steps in monitoring or treatment.

Finally, biopsies may be performed to confirm the presence of recurrent cancer. This involves extracting a small tissue sample from a suspected tumor site, which is then examined microscopically by a pathologist. Depending on the location of the tumor, biopsy procedures can range from minimally invasive techniques to more surgical approaches. The results of a biopsy are critical, as they provide definitive information on whether cancer has returned, informing treatment options and care plans.

Treatment Options If Cancer Returns

The return of cancer, often termed recurrence, raises a multitude of concerns for patients and healthcare providers. As the landscape of cancer treatment evolves, various effective treatment options can be considered for addressing recurrence, tailored to individual circumstances.

Surgery may be a primary recourse, depending on the type and location of the cancer. In cases where the recurrence is localized, surgical intervention can potentially remove tumors that have appeared following initial treatment. This approach often differs from initial surgery, as prior treatments may have altered the tumor’s characteristics or surrounding tissues, necessitating a customized surgical strategy.

Chemotherapy is another common treatment modality for recurrent cancer. It employs drugs to target and eliminate cancer cells, sometimes using combinations that differ from prior regimens. The choice of specific chemotherapy agents typically depends on the cancer type, previous responses to treatment, and the overall health of the patient, allowing oncologists to refine treatment based on past experiences.

Radiation therapy may also be utilized as an effective means to address recurrent cancer. It can be particularly beneficial in targeting tumors that remain after surgery or arise in previously treated areas. The radiation plan may vary significantly from earlier treatments due to the need to minimize exposure to surrounding healthy tissue and optimize therapeutic outcomes.

Immunotherapy has emerged as a revolutionary option, harnessing the body’s own immune system to defend against cancer. Different from conventional therapies, immunotherapy may be especially advantageous for certain cancer types. Personalized assessments are crucial for determining the appropriateness of these newer therapies in the context of recurrence.

Additionally, targeted therapy represents a significant advancement in cancer treatment. By focusing on specific molecular targets associated with cancer growth, these therapies can provide a more personalized approach compared to traditional methods. Adjustments are often made based on molecular testing of the recurrent tumor, ensuring that the chosen therapy aligns with the cancer’s specific characteristics.

Overall, the selection of treatment options in the event of cancer recurrence should be approached with a comprehensive evaluation of the patient’s history, current health status, and specific cancer attributes. Tailoring treatment plans enhances the likelihood of achieving optimal outcomes amidst the challenges posed by a recurrence.

Emotional and Psychological Impact of Recurrence

Receiving news of cancer recurrence can be an overwhelming experience, often triggering a complex array of emotions that can have a profound impact on an individual’s mental well-being. Patients may find themselves grappling with fear, anxiety, and uncertainty about the future. Fear of worsening symptoms or a decline in quality of life can resurface, compounded by the previous battle with cancer. This experience often ignites feelings of powerlessness as patients confront the possibility of undergoing treatment once again.

Moreover, recurrence may lead to heightened anxiety levels, as patients might constantly worry about their health status. It is not uncommon for individuals to feel trapped in a cycle of negative thoughts, exacerbating their emotional distress. The uncertainty that accompanies recurrence can make individuals question their past decisions and lifestyle choices, potentially leading to a sense of guilt or perceived failure in their health management.

To address these emotional challenges, coping mechanisms become essential. Seeking mental health support through counseling can provide a safe space for patients to express their feelings, process their experiences, and cultivate strategies for resilience. Licensed mental health professionals can help navigate complex emotional landscapes, offering personalized therapeutic approaches that foster healing. Additionally, joining support groups enables individuals to connect with others who have undergone similar experiences, fostering a sense of community and understanding.

Mindfulness practices, such as meditation and yoga, can also serve as effective tools for enhancing emotional regulation and reducing anxiety. These practices encourage individuals to cultivate present-moment awareness, promoting a sense of calm amidst distressing thoughts. Incorporating such techniques into daily routines can encourage not only acceptance of the present situation but also equip individuals with vital coping strategies as they navigate the intricacies of recurrence.

Integrative Approaches to Manage Recurrence

When faced with the possibility of cancer recurrence, patients often seek holistic strategies that complement conventional treatment methods. Integrative medicine encompasses various approaches including dietary changes, physical activity, stress management techniques, and nutritional supplements. Each of these elements can play a pivotal role in bolstering overall health during this sensitive time.

Dietary modifications are fundamental in managing not only cancer recurrence but also enhancing general well-being. A diet rich in fruits, vegetables, whole grains, and lean proteins can provide critical nutrients that support the immune system. Some studies suggest that certain food items, like cruciferous vegetables and berries, possess anti-cancer properties. Integrating healthy fats, such as those found in fish, nuts, and olive oil, may also contribute to improved health outcomes. It is essential that patients work closely with dietitians or nutritionists who have experience in oncology to tailor a meal plan that aligns with their specific health needs.

Regular physical activity has been associated with reducing recurrence rates in some cancer types. Exercise can improve physical strength, enhance mood, and reduce fatigue, making it a valuable tool for those navigating the aftermath of cancer treatment. Guidelines recommend a combination of aerobic exercises and strength training tailored to the individual’s capabilities. Consultation with a fitness expert specializing in oncology can provide personalized and safe exercise regimens.

Stress management is equally important, as emotional and psychological stress can affect the body’s ability to recover. Techniques such as yoga, meditation, and mindfulness have been shown to reduce stress and promote a sense of well-being. Moreover, engaging in support groups allows individuals to share their experiences, fostering an environment of understanding and reciprocity.

Lastly, while certain supplements may offer benefits, it is crucial that patients consult their healthcare providers before incorporating any new therapies. Some supplements could interact negatively with prescribed treatments. This careful consideration helps ensure a safe and comprehensive approach to managing the risk of cancer recurrence.

Future Research and Advances in Cancer Recurrence Prevention

The landscape of cancer treatment and prevention is rapidly evolving, particularly regarding the recurring nature of this disease. Current research trends emphasize a multifaceted approach to understanding cancer recurrence and developing innovative strategies to mitigate it. A key focus is the ongoing clinical trials aimed at assessing new therapies that target specific pathways associated with tumor regrowth. Researchers are examining combinations of existing treatments, such as immunotherapy and targeted therapies, to enhance their efficacy in preventing relapse.

Additionally, breakthroughs in genetic testing are revolutionizing how healthcare providers approach cancer recurrence. With advances in next-generation sequencing, it is now possible to identify genetic mutations and alterations that may predispose individuals to relapse. By integrating this genetic information, oncologists can tailor treatment plans more effectively and monitor patients closely for early signs of recurrence. This personalized medicine approach not only increases the likelihood of successful treatment outcomes but also helps in stratifying patients based on their recurrence risk.

Furthermore, developments in precision medicine are paving the way for new therapies specifically designed to combat the mechanisms underlying cancer recurrence. Researchers are investigating how the tumor microenvironment, including immune responses and cellular interactions, contributes to the chance of relapse. Such insights could lead to targeted interventions aimed at modifying the tumor microenvironment, potentially thwarting recurrence before it begins.

As these research efforts progress, they hold promise for improving patient outcomes and reducing the emotional and physical toll that recurrence can impose.
